A main idea of passkeys is that the private keys are bound to hardware and cannot be copied. Using the private key is subject to biometric authentication. This eliminates a whole category of issues where the private key could get stolen. So no, writing down the SSH private key is not the solution. Currently, none of the big players in the passkey space support exporting or importing of passkeys, because the spec for doing this securely has not been agreed upon, and nobody wants to allow plaintext export of passkeys.
